When removing the power PCB to install the MCR adapter, can you also replace the 800 ton power brick with just a basic iso setup, or do you have to keep the original power brick in there for some reason?
 
Yeah leave it alone.. if soe some reason you had to go back youd be prtty pissed, and if you ever sold it most of us like games as original as possible so leaving the original brick in there is a good idea.

On my tron, i had enough room so that i was able to mount my new ps and arcadeshop adapter by hooking the adapter board behind my old pcr board then putting in two screws on the top. SOmple clean and easy to convert back, leaving all original parts unmolested( other then not bieng hooked up that is)
 
If it's a Tron you can take out the "Big Blue" cap assembly and leave the rest. Otherwise, just leave it.
 
It's for a Tapper, and I'm hoping to use the original. Its working condition is unknown and I just wanted to see if it was possible to do without it if need be.

How much of a hassle is it to rebuild the original if it's non-working? I'm assuming the necessary parts are available?
 
Two big caps and a transformer which can be found all over the place is all you should need to fix it. BTW, my journey machine came with the MCR conversion and though more reliable, i wasn't fond of the hacks that had to be made to the harness and i ended up switching it all back and using an unhacked journey harness for the restore.. Tapper, timber, journey, spy hunter, wacko, demolition derby and a few more all use the same power brick.
